The Film Yap’s Movies to watch at home: ‘Athlete A,’ ‘Irresistible,’ ‘Eurovision Song Contest: The Story of Fire Saga,’ more

Movie theaters may be shut down right now, but there are still new movies for you to watch being released regularly. We checked in with Christopher Lloyd of The Film Yap to see what’s streaming, available digitally/on-demand and new on disc.

New On Digital/Demand:

Irresistible — Steve Carell plays a soulless political operative
who moves to a tiny Wisconsin town to flip a red mayoral seat blue in this fun,
smart satie from writer/director Jon Stewart. Co-starring Chris Cooper and Rose
Byrne.

House of Hummingbird — This South Korean drama looks at a
14-year-old girl floating through life feeling disconnected, trying out
relationships before connecting with a new teacher.

Daddy Issues — When a struggling Brit comedian moves to Los Angeles to take over her estranged father’s company after he dies, she finds herself struggling to prove herself.

New on Disc:

A Good Woman Is Hard to Find — Sarah Bolger plays a working-class
British widow seeking answers about her dead husband when she strikes up a
strange relationship with a criminal.

Cool on Streaming:

Eurovision Song Contest: The Story of Fire Saga — Rachel McAdams
and Will Ferrell play no-talent Icelanders who dream of competing in Europe’s
biggest singing competition. On Netflix now.

Athlete A — A straightforward but powerful documentary about the
Indianapolis Star investigation into an abusive gymnast doctor that opened up a
river of victims.
